  • Solstice - Wikipedia
    A solstice is the time when the Sun reaches its most northerly or southerly excursion relative to the celestial equator on the celestial sphere Two solstices occur annually, around 20–22 June and 20–22 December In many countries, the seasons of the year are defined by reference to the solstices and the equinoxes

  • Solstice | Definition Facts | Britannica
    Solstice, either of the two moments in the year when the Sun’s apparent path is farthest north or south from Earth’s Equator In the Northern Hemisphere the summer solstice occurs on June 20 or 21 and the winter solstice on December 21 or 22

  • Solstice - National Geographic Society
    A solstice is an event in which a planet ’s poles are most extremely inclined toward or away from the star it orbits On our planet, solstices are defined by solar declination —the latitude of Earth where the sun is directly overhead at noon
